what should be your expectations from qa team lead
Wanneer een onderwerp, vooral een procesgebaseerd onderwerp (bijvoorbeeld: Een traceerbaarheidsmatrix maken of test documentatie review , etc) wordt besproken in de klas, de directe vraag die ik krijg is: “Wie doet dit? De QA-leider of het teamlid '
Dit is een geweldig bewijs dat beginners het moeilijk hebben om de reikwijdte van het werk, de rollen en verantwoordelijkheden te begrijpen. Ze hebben hier slechts een vaag idee van en zijn vaak op zoek naar manieren om te valideren of hun begrip juist is of niet. En als u denkt dat dit alleen een probleem is voor nieuwkomers, heeft u het mis. Veel managers / leads / coördinatoren vinden de roldefinitie / delegatie van werk ook een probleem vanwege onduidelijkheid op dit gebied - wat je zelf moet doen en wat te delegeren is vaak een dilemma voor de QA-leads.
Zoals sommigen van jullie misschien denken, vroeg ik me ook af: 'Wat als ze het om te beginnen niet weten? Zullen ze er niet achter komen als ze gaan? ' Ja dat doen ze. Maar veel tijd, efficiëntie en kwaliteit komen daarbij in het gedrang.
gebruik van c ++ in de echte wereld
Om dat allemaal te voorkomen, hebben we de belangrijkste taken die deel uitmaken van STLC en de respectievelijke verantwoordelijkheden in de vorm van de onderstaande tabel op een rijtje gezet:
Wat je leert:
- Verantwoordelijkheden van de teamleider voor verschillende QA-activiteiten:
- Een paar tips voor QA-teamleden:
- Tips voor QA-teamleiders:
- Aanbevolen literatuur
Verantwoordelijkheden van de teamleider voor verschillende QA-activiteiten:
STLC-activiteit | QA Teamleider Taken | Teamlid taken |
---|---|---|
Test documentatie review - intern | Stel regels op op basis waarvan de beoordeling moet plaatsvinden Stel tijdlijnen en verantwoordelijkheden in een van de peers zijn en betrokken zijn bij het beoordelingsproces | Voer een beoordeling uit op basis van de ingestelde regels en geef niet-persoonlijke opmerkingen over het werk van uw collega |
Start van het project | Creëer en presenteer de projecthoogtepunten aan het QA-team en andere belanghebbenden | Om te helpen en de teamleider op de hoogte te stellen van eventuele verbeteringen of inconsistenties |
Testplanning | Testplan opstellen, onderhouden, beheren en afdwingen Risicoanalyse en -beheer | Om input te leveren over delen van het testplan-document, zoals: Reikwijdte Veronderstellingen Risico's Mijlpalen en elk ander gebied waarop het teamlid een inbreng heeft. |
Verzamelen van vereisten | Verdeel het werk op basis van modules van de applicatie en kies teamleden als aanspreekpunt voor elke module Bepaal een tijdstip waarop dit moet plaatsvinden Laat het team weten wat er als uitkomst wordt verwacht (bijv .: lijst met vereisten in een beknopt punt voor punt, document begrijpen, enz.) | Neem de leiding over uw individuele module Verzamel vereisten via BRD / FRD-evaluatie- of walkthrough-vergaderingen Presenteer / documenteer ze in het verwachte formaat, binnen de tijd die voor deze activiteit is uitgetrokken Geef suggesties of een ander standpunt in het geval van incompatibele formaten of onhaalbare tijdlijnen |
Testscenario maken | Werkverdeling Vraagresolutie Sjabloon finaliseren Deadlines stellen Deelnemen en bijdragen aan het maken van testscenario's | Maak testscenario's voor de module die aan u is toegewezen, met in de ingestelde tijdlijn en in het formaat dat al is afgesproken. Zoek een oplossing bij de teamleider of bij de respectieve technische teams in geval van vragen |
Testcase documentatie | Werkverdeling Vraagresolutie Sjabloon finaliseren Schrijf testcases | Maak testcases en data, indien van toepassing |
Traceerbaarheid Matrix maken | Maak een sjabloon en deel de richtlijnen voor het maken van een TM Werk samen met het team en draag eraan bij | Draag bij aan de totstandkoming van het TM voor de modules waarvoor u individueel verantwoordelijk bent |
Test documentatie review - extern | Informeer het BA en / of dev team dat de testdocumentatie (testcases) klaar is voor review en stuur het werkproduct op | Stand-by om eventuele wijzigingen die tijdens het beoordelingsproces worden voorgesteld, op te nemen |
Test gereedheidsbeoordeling | Maak de controlelijst Voer de beoordeling uit en presenteer de resultaten aan de projectmanager Basisgezondheid en rooktest en bepalen - zijn we klaar om te testen? Geef het QA-team toestemming om te testen | Wacht op instructies over gereedheid Voer een eenvoudige rook- en gezondheidstest uit voor de modules waarvoor u individueel verantwoordelijk bent |
Test uitvoering | Stel richtlijnen voor het uitvoeren van tests op nadat u de input van het team hebt gezocht Werk aan testuitvoering Help nieuwe testers om aan de slag te gaan met de huidige applicatie Meld defecten Bekijk de defecten die door de teamleden zijn gemeld om er zeker van te zijn dat ze geldig zijn, geen duplicaten en volledig in de beschrijving Escaleer alle showstoppers en neem beslissingen over hoe verder te gaan in dergelijke situaties | Voer testcases uit, stel de juiste testcasestatussen in en rapporteer de voortgang Breng onmiddellijk op de hoogte van showstoppers of problemen die de testtijdlijnen beïnvloeden Rapporteer defecten uitgebreid |
Rapporteren | Stuur dagelijkse statusrapporten naar alle belanghebbenden Vertegenwoordig het QA-team in statusbijeenkomsten Verzamel statistieken op basis van algemene teststatistieken | Help de teamleider bij alle taken die worden uitgevoerd |
Test sluiting | Evalueer de exitcriteria voor wanneer u moet stoppen met testen Deel de resultaten van de evaluatie van de exitcriteria Als aan alle exitcriteria is voldaan, maakt u het testafsluitingsrapport op en stuurt u dit naar de belanghebbenden met de officiële QA-goedkeuring, inclusief een lijst met bekende problemen Verzamel details over het algehele project - de successen, verbeterpunten, geleerde lessen, geïmplementeerde best practices, enz. En presenteer ze in de project retrospectievergadering of het document. | Help de teamleider bij het afsluiten van de tests |
UAT | Verzamel de acceptatiecriteria van de UAT-gebruikers om de parameters voor hun evaluatie te begrijpen Deel de acceptatiecriteria met het team en werk samen met hen aan het verzamelen of creëren van UAT-testcases Train indien nodig de UAT-gebruikers in de applicatie Sta indien nodig klaar voor hulp tijdens UAT Voer indien nodig enkele taken uit tijdens UAT en presenteer de resultaten aan de klant of UAT-gebruikers voor hun go / no-go-beslissing | Maak / verzamel UAT-testcases Voer of assisteer bij UAT - wanneer dat nodig is |
Voor alle processen die in de bovenstaande tabel worden genoemd, volgt u de onderstaande links voor meer informatie:
- Testplan maken
- Verzamelen van vereisten en schrijven van testscenario's
- Testcase schrijven
- Test documentatie review
- Traceerbaarheidsmatrix maken
- Test gereedheidscontrole en checklist exitcriteria
- Statusrapportage
- UAT
Een paar tips voor QA-teamleden:
1) Maak uw testcases, defectrapporten etc. NIET in de verwachting dat als er problemen zijn, de teamleider deze voor u zal vinden en oplossen. Elk individu is verantwoordelijk voor zijn werkproduct en de kwaliteit ervan. De beoordeling van een teamleider is gebruikelijk als extra ijkpunt en is meestal van hoog niveau.
twee) Verwacht dagelijks weinig tot geen handen vast te houden. Geen enkele teamleider mag ons elke dag vertellen wat we moeten doen.
3) Communiceer vooruit in geval van zorgen, rode vlaggen of problemen.
4) Tenzij uw proces u hiertoe beperkt, kunt u als u vragen heeft over de functionaliteit of technische details zelf contact opnemen met de ontwikkelaars / BA's / andere technische teams, zonder te vertrouwen op de leiding van uw team om de informatie voor u door te geven.
Tips voor QA-teamleiders:
1) Houd rekening met de mening van het team over tijdlijnen, planningen, inschattingen van inspanningen en planning
twee) Breng sterke processen tot stand zodat het team onafhankelijk kan werken met een minimum aan of geen toezicht
3) Houd de communicatiekanalen open en wees benaderbaar
4) Wees een teamspeler en deel verantwoordelijkheden
Lees ook Hoe bouw je een succesvol QA-team op? Leiderschap in testen Deel 1 en Deel 2 hier.
Over de auteur: Dit artikel is geschreven door STH-teamlid Swati S.
hoe u het .bin-bestand installeert
Dat is een snelle afronding van de taken en taken van teamleiders en teamleden in een typisch QA-team. Deel zoals altijd hieronder uw ervaringen, opmerkingen en vragen.
Aanbevolen literatuur
- Leiderschap bij het testen - Verantwoordelijkheden van testleiders en hoe u het testteam effectief kunt beheren
- Teambuilding bij softwaretests - hoe u uw QA-team kunt opbouwen en uitbreiden
- Hoe word je een goede teammentor, coach en een echte teamverdediger in een agile testwereld? - De inspiratie
- Hoe u teamspel- en leiderschapgerelateerde interviewvragen kunt beantwoorden voor de positie van een testleider
- ISTQB-testcertificering Voorbeeldvragen met antwoorden
- Hoe u een gelukkiger en succesvol testteam leidt - Testleiderschap Deel 2
- Hoe u een uitstekende QA-testpresentatie voorbereidt en aan het team geeft
- Hoe u een succesvol QA-team opbouwt